KUCHING: After 40 years at the helm, Tan Sri Alfred Jabu Numpang will let go of his deputy president post in Parti Pesaka Bumiputera Bersatu (PBB).
The 77-year-old will make way for Deputy Chief Minister Datuk Amar Douglas Uggah Embas who will take up the role of acting deputy president, along with Datuk Amar Awang Tengah Ali Hassan.
